Lives Impacted in Guatemala

February 1, 2024 | By Shannon Meadors

On January 18, Nashville First sent eight members to the Lake Atitlan region of Guatemala to partner with Volunteer Baptists International to lead a three-day children’s camp. Forty children attended the camp, and eighteen children trusted Jesus as Savior!

Using LifeWay’s ‘Twist & Turns’ VBS curriculum as our guide, our leaders taught each rotation prepared, prayerful, and with passion … and using an interpreter! Scott Payne and Melinda Matthews taught the Bible study on Peter’s encounters with Jesus. The children learned songs in Spanish, with Joe Fitzpatrick and Joan Lehning leading the music rotation. Kyle Meadors taught recreation and had a ball playing soccer relays and tag games. Shannon Meadors and Cheryl White guided the group through crafts which included tie-dying t-shirts, beading bracelets, and making Polaroid picture frames. All were a big hit. Trevor Brown caught all the action on camera capturing over 3000 photos and videos which will be shown at The Gathering on February 18.

The gospel was shared multiple times through the rotations and during worship. On Saturday evening, an altar call was given around the evening bonfire. Our hearts were full of gratitude as boys and girls came forward to give their lives to Jesus. The night ended with our VBI hosts and children singing “How Great Thou Art” in Spanish.
